Power Rangers Zeo is an American television series created by Haim Saban and the fourth season of the Power Rangers franchise, began airing April 20, 1996 on Fox Kids. The series follows a group of teenagers chosen by the wise sage Zordon to become "Power Rangers" in order to stop the forces of evil from taking over the planet Earth. Zeo comprises 50 episodes and concluded its initial airing November 27, 1996. Zeo uses footage and elements from the Super Sentai series Chōriki Sentai Ohranger and is the first series in Power Rangers that is part of the annual Ranger suit change to match the annual change of the Super Sentai series. Regular cast members during Zeo include Catherine Sutherland, Nakia Burrise, Steve Cardenas, Johnny Yong Bosch, Jason David Frank, David Yost, Paul Schrier, Jason Narvy, Richard Genelle, Gregg Bullock. Austin St. John later re-joins the cast and Yost leaves toward the end.

Zeo picks up directly after the previous series Mighty Morphin Power Rangers and Mighty Morphin Alien Rangers end with the explosion of the Command Center after the Rangers complete the Zeo Crystal. The Rangers are given their new Zeo powers to combat the Machine Empire who kick Rita Repulsa and Lord Zedd out of their palace on the moon and become the primary villains the Rangers must face. Meanwhile, while facing the Machine Empire, the Rangers must also discover the secret identity of an unknown Gold Ranger who also seems to have the power of the Zeo Crystal. Bulk (Schrier) and Skull (Narvy) continue on as police officers, until they get Lt. Stone (Bullock) dismissed and join him in founding a detective agency.
